             Update

   Extreme Assault Version 1.2.0

      (C) Blue Byte 1997

-------------------------------------
-------------------------------------

- Improved network scoring.

- Now supports the Voodoo Rush 3Dfx-
  cards! (with DRIVER.TXT)

-------------------------------------
-------------------------------------

Important!
Due to these changes the current
version of Extreme Assault is no
longer compatible for network use
with older versions.
So if you intend to play Extreme
Assault via the internet (Kali) or on
a local network, make sure that all
participants have the same version of
the program! (This should also apply
to our upcoming release on the Mplayer
gaming network.)

Update Directions
-------------------------------------

*Copy the file 'XA_E120.EXE' into your
current Extreme Assault directory.
(usually C:\BLUEBYTE\EXTREME)

*Start the update program by typing
XA_E120 [RETURN],or just double-click
on the file if in Windows 95.

*The program will then ask you where
the original program is located.
Simply press the [RETURN] key.

*Follow the simple commands, wait a 
minute, and your Extreme Assault will
be updated to version 1.2.0.

*ONLY FOR VOODOO RUSH 3D VIDEO CARDS*
--------------------------------------
*First, make sure that you've installed 
the latest drivers for card.
(Glide Runtime Drivers for Voodoo
Graphics and Voodoo Rush for versions
2.42 and higher are to be found at
http://www.3dfx.com/software/
dowunload_glidert.html; updated 10/97)

If you're still having problems starting
the game, you'll need to install an 
older version of Glide2x.ovl.

*Make sure you have the 'DRIVER.EXE' file
installed in your EXTREME directory.

*Start the file by entering DRIVER in DOS
mode, or simply double clicking it from 
Windows 95.

*Click on 'Unzip' to start.

*When asked to overwrite the file click
'Yes.'

*Click on 'OK' then 'Close.'

*Then go back and double click on (or 
type in DOS mode) Xa_3Dfx to start the 
optimized version of Extreme Assault.

What's New?
-------------------------------------

*Better Network Evaluation:
The problem associated with the
erroneous hit computations in network
mode (which is rare) has now been
corrected.

*Better 3Dfx Support:
This version of Extreme Assault
supports 3Dfx-cards with the Voodoo
Rush chip (like the Hercules Stingray
128/3D card).
Owners of these cards can now enjoy the
speed and graphic quality of the program.

*Note-Most Voodoo Rush owners will need 
to use the DRIVER.EXE file also for best 
results.
